My taskbar is stuck in the up position and I like to have it hide itself
when not in use. For some reason this has stopped working. I have chosen the
"autohide taskbar" option under "Properties" on the right-clicked taskbar
menu. The taskbar hid itself once then stuck back up again and won't go down
into hidden position. Why might this happen and how to fix it?

Try this:
Enter task manager, find explorer.exe and end that process. Go to file in
the task manager window and click new task(run).
Type "Explorer"
click OK

Then you may notice that some of the icons on the system tray are already
gone. If you have Ghost installed, it has a system tray application which is
keeping the taskbar up because its continually in use. If you close Ghost's
helper, the taskbar would behave correctly. Other applications may be similar
so try exiting them in your system tray.
